Bedfordshire pub appeals for '˜epic' love stories this Valentine's Day

With Valentine's Day fast approaching the team at the Knife & Cleaver in Houghton Conquest are celebrating the best love stories.

The pub want to hear from Bedfordshire couples with ‘epic’ love stories.

To celebrate Valentine’s Day, the pub is offering the couple who impresses the judges most with their love story, a romantic three-course dinner for two, an overnight stay in one of its rooms and a breakfast the next day.
